Mergers software covers a broad collection of digital tools and platforms that facilitate collaboration as well as data management, analysis and decision-making across all phases of M&A activity. This includes due diligence valuation deals, deal sourcing and screening, M&A modeling, post-merger integration management, and much more. M&A solutions typically include tools to help teams streamline workflows and automate tasks as well as support compliance with regulations, and to protect data privacy and security via encryption, access control and other safeguards.

M&A models should be capable of importing a vast array of information from sources such as financial statements, operational metrics, market research and data as well as regulatory information and more – all of which can then be used to build multi-dimensional models. They should be able to be flexible and scalable, so that they can meet the requirements of a wide range of users including attorneys and payment processors. Quantrix is a powerful tool which offers a variety of modeling capabilities, from discounted cash flow analysis (DCF) to merger consequences analysis and sensitive analysis is a great example.

In addition to core M&A software, some vendors provide a greater array of tools and services, like virtual data rooms or research databases. For instance, Grata offers a database of public and private companies that can be searched by location, business or industry, and each listing includes verified contact details for executives. Grata doesn’t release pricing publicly but will provide a quote upon request. SS&C Intralinks offers a complete M&A platform that is enhanced by tools like DealRoom and Expanding Topics.
